History of The Evelyn Building

The Evelyn resides in a landmark building that originally opened in 1905. Designed by esteemed American architect Robert T. Lyons, the building functioned for decades as a women's boarding house called the Martha Washington Hotel.

In 2015, the structure underwent extensive renovations by Glen Coben Architects to transform it into The Evelyn, a high-end boutique hotel. The redesign preserved original details like the intricate terracotta facade and crystal chandeliers while incorporating modern elements.

NoMad Neighborhood

Short for North of Madison Square Park, NoMad stretches from East 25th Street to West 30th Street between Broadway and Lexington Avenue. NoMad has quickly become one of Manhattan's trendiest neighborhoods.
